Bowling ball
Explanation:
Momentum, p is calculated by multiplying the mass and velocity of an object hence expressed as p=mv where m and v represent mass and velocity respectively.
Momentum of golf ball
For the golf ball, the momentum will be given by substituting 0.046 kg for m and 60 m/s for v hence moment is equivalent to 0.046 kg*60 m/s=2.76 kg.m/s
Momentum for bowling ball
The momentum of bowling ball is also calculated by substituting the mass as 7kg and velocity as 6 m/s hence p=7*6=42 kg.m/s
Evidently, 42 is greater than 2.76 hence momentum of bowling ball is the greatest of the two
